Distribution and Expression of Visfatin-Positive Cells in the Spleen of Lipopolysaccharide-Stimulated Piglets International Journal of Morphology
Xiao,Ke; Qiu,Chang-Wei; Chen,Min; Yang,Zhi; Wang,Jing; Peng,Ke-Mei; Song,Hui.
The histological changes in the spleen and the immunohistochemical expression of visfatin in lipopolysaccharide-stimulated piglets are reported to examine the relation between visfatin and inflammation. The results are as follows: (1) After LPS treated, the spleen displayed thicker capsules and trabecula, the thinner periarterial lymphatic sheath, and the more expandable splenic sinusoid, with an increase in the number of splenic nodules, lymphocytes, ellipsoids of the marginal zone, red blood cells and macrophagocytes. (2) Visfatin-positive cells were mainly distributed in the red pulp of the spleen, with less in splenic nodules and periarterial lymphatic sheath. Effect of Visfatin on the Structure and Immune Levels in the Small Intestine of LPS-Induced Rats International Journal of Morphology
Zhou,Ying; Cui,Lu; Yuan,Huairui; Xiao,Ke; Khan,Faheem Ahmed; Guo,Liang; Yang,Zhi; Song,Hui.
This study investigated the effects of visfatin on the structure and the immunity levels in the small intestine of LPS-induced rats. Forty Wistar male and female SPF rats were randomly and equally divided into four groups: the saline (control), vistfatin, lipopolysaccharide (LPS), and visfatin+LPS co-stimulated. The functions of visfatin in the intestinal mucosal immunity were investigated by examining the variation of tissue structure, inflammation and immunity-related proteins in the intestine of immunologically stressed rats using HE staining, ELISA, immunohistochemistry and Western Blot. Effects of Supplemental Boron on Intestinal Proliferation and Apoptosis in African Ostrich Chicks International Journal of Morphology
Sun,PengPeng; Luo,You; Wu,Xin Tong; Ansari,Abdur Rahman; Wang,Jing; Yang,KeLi; Xiao,Ke; Peng,KeMei.
Boron is an essential trace element which plays an important role in process of metabolism and the function of the tissues. However, the effects of boron on the intestinal cells in African ostrich chicks are poorly reported. Therefore, this study was designed to investigate the role of boron on proliferation and apoptosis of the intestinal cells. A total of 36, ten day-old ostrich chicks were randomly divided into six groups and fed on the same basal diet supplemented with 0, 40, 80, 160, 320 and 640 mg/L boric acid in drinking water for 80 days. Proliferatingcell nuclearantigen (PCNA) wasused to test the proliferation indexof intestine in different group byimmunohistochemicalstaining (IHC). Influence of isoniazid on T lymphocytes, cytokines, and macrophages in rats BJPS
Cao,Bianchuan; Li,Qiuju; Huang,Zhe; Huang,Xiufang; Zhu,Yihong; Xiao,Ke; Huang,Fuli; Zhong,Li.
T lymphocytes, cytokines, and macrophages play important roles in the clearance of Mycobacterium tuberculosis (Mtb) by the immune system. This study aimed to investigate the effects of isoniazid on the functions of both innate and adaptive immune cells. Healthy rats were randomly divided into experimental and control groups. Each group was randomly divided into three subgroups and named according to the duration of drug feeding, 1, 3, and 3 months followed by drug withdrawal for 1 month. The experimental groups were fed with isoniazid (12 mg/mL) and the control groups with normal saline. The Effect of Visfatin on Inflammatory Reaction in Uterus of LPS-Induced Rats International Journal of Morphology
Yang,Zhi; Xiao,Ke; Wang,Wei; Tang,Juan; Sun,Peng-Peng; Peng,Ke-Mei; Song,Hui.
The present study was to investigate the effects of visfatin on the morphological structure and function of the rat uterus during inflammation. The expression and distribution of visfatin, morphological structure, eosinophils (EOS), myeloperoxidase (MPO) and cytokines in the uterus of the LPS-induced rat were studied using hematoxylin-eosin staining (HE), immunohistochemical methods, western blots and enzyme-linked immunosorbent assay (ELISA). The present study showed that visfatin positive cells dispersed widely in the uterus, and strong positive staining was observed mainly in the cell cytoplasm.
